Marathi language row: MNS workers held over vandalism at Entrepreneur Sushil Kedia's office
At least five Maharashtra Navnirman Sena (MNS) workers were detained by Mumbai Police for allegedly vandalising the Worli office of entrepreneur Sushil Kedia. The act is believed to be linked to Kedia’s controversial remarks about MNS and its chief, Raj Thackeray, amid the ongoing Marathi language row in Maharashtra.
